aside from when it is a twisted up mess, as noted above, i think the string is a work of genius. most of my time is in the astar and their airspeed indication is somewhat lacking at low speeds, so the string is ever useful when working at high density altitudes. the 407 has a pretty good pitot-static system, but i find the string much easier to use when on short final to cliff side pads.
